Ros2 create_timer python
WebJan 16, 2024 · 原文链接: ROS2 Python ... # 设置定时器,周期调用定时器回调函数timer_callback timer_period = 1.0 self.tmr = self.create_timer(timer_period, … WebCreating a Timer. Creating a Timer is done through the ros::NodeHandle::createTimer () method: Toggle line numbers. 1 ros::Timer timer = nh.createTimer(ros::Duration(0.1), …
Ros2 create_timer python
Did you know?
WebThe implementation from client library will provide Time, Duration, and Rate datatypes, for all three time source abstractions. The Clock will support a sleep_for function as well as a … WebOct 28, 2024 · 为此,本博客将介绍基于python的ROS2的时间同步方法。 本博客内容结构为话题发布代码,话题订阅与时间同步代码,代码文件夹结构及结果显示图片。 本博客假 …
WebThe wall timer calls a function called a "callback function" every time it goes off. You define this function yourself and that means you can do anything you like inside it. For example: … WebApr 3, 2024 · Now, following the ros2 documentation on how to setup a virtual environment, set up one and install a dependency (for example, jinja2) and activate it. cd test-ws/src python3 -m venv venv --system-site-packages --symlinks source ./venv/bin/activate touch ./venv/COLCON_IGNORE python3 -m pip install jinja2. build the workspace and source it.
WebROS2入门教程—自定义话题及服务消息类型_拓展1 创建功能包2 创建msg文件3 编译msg文件4 设置多个接口5 编写发布者节点代码5.1 代码解释5.2 修改CMakeLists.txt5.3 链接接口6 …
WebApr 25, 2024 · functionality using rcl clocks: create timer with clock #211. let users specify the clock to use: update this TODO Timer uses ROS time by default #419. Implement a …
WebMay 6, 2024 · ROS2演習5-2024:トピック通信しよう!. (Python) この記事は私が金沢工業大学ロボティクス学科で担当している2024年度後学期に担当したロボットプログラミン … can you get scizor in fire redWebMar 23, 2024 · ROS2 (Python) Timer callback only calling once when I call spin_once ( ) within it. I have a ros2 callback that I'd like to call once a second, which makes several … can you get scoliosis by slouchingWebMar 8, 2024 · 0. answered Mar 25 '21. charlie92. 87 7 14 13. I think one way to do it, is to call self.destroy_timer at the end of your timer callback function, and then if you need again … can you get scorpions in englandWebCreate a Package. Open a new terminal window, and navigate to the src directory of your workspace: cd ~/dev_ws/src. Now let’s create a package named cv_basics. Type this command (this is all a single command): ros2 pkg create --build-type ament_python cv_basics --dependencies rclpy image_transport cv_bridge sensor_msgs std_msgs … can you get scouted at 16Web2024.2.24:补充了point_cloud2.create_cloud的函数说明. 实现. 参考博客 点云发布(pointcloud_publisher)之ROS2案例. 点云数据类型包含了以下数据类型. uint32 height: … can you get scouted at 19WebApr 11, 2024 · 1 创建一个包. 打开一个新终端并 source,这样 ros2 命令就可以工作了。. 导航到在 上一教程 dev_ws 中创建的目录。. 回想一下,应该在 src 目录中创建包,而不是在工作空间的根目录中。. 因此,导航到 dev_ws/src 并运行包创建命令:. ros2 pkg create --build-type ament_cmake ... can you get scouted at 14Web【Python】【项目模拟】模拟火车订票系统. 本项目代码基于python大作业——列车管理系统_丿灬慕容笑笑的博客-CSDN博客_python 车票管理系统 的代码,本人对其进行重新 … brighton heights funeral shooting